Our future dental professionals took a trip to Montgomery County Community College to check out the Dental Hygiene program. They watched students in action in the clinic, toured the space, and got the inside scoop on how the program works, plus what it takes to get accepted. Real-world exposure, real pathways, real goals.

Thirty MBIT students pulled up to the SkillsUSA Fall Leadership Conference at Kalahari Resorts in the Poconos and absolutely owned it.
They brought the energy, the talent, and the teamwork, and it paid off big:
🏆 1st Place Spirit Award
🥇 Gold – Poster Design
🥉 Bronze – Pin Design
